BNL PRE-PROPOSAL CONFERENCE SET FOR THURSDAY

By ExchangeMonitor

Will there be a challenge to incumbent Brookhaven Science Associates at Brookhaven National Laboratory? An answer to that question could come into sharper focus this week as the Department of Energy holds a pre-proposal conference Thursday for its BNL procurement. The meeting will include a tour of the laboratory as well as insight into the recently released Request for Proposals. BSA is a partnership of Battelle and Stony Brook University, and its contract expires Jan. 4, 2015. BNL is the first Department of Energy Office of Science contract competed since the Princeton Plasma Physics Laboratory in 2009, and a handful of companies have shown interest in the contract, including Fluor, CB&I, IBM, URS, Booz Allen Hamilton, Arcadis, and Fermilab contractor Universities Research Association. Representatives from Enercon Federal Services, Fortinet, MicroTech, Professional Services of America, and Protection Strategies Inc. also attended an industry day for the contract last year.
